Ukiah, CA (November 30, 2024) – A fatal head-on traffic collision occurred on SR 1, near the Casper Bridge, at approximately 9:55 PM on November 28, 2024. The crash involved a van and a sedan, with both vehicles becoming trapped in the collision. Emergency responders, including units from Mendocino County, arrived at the scene shortly after the crash was reported. Tragically, two individuals were confirmed deceased at the scene. Both northbound and southbound lanes on the bridge were completely blocked as a result of the wreck.
Medics and fire crews worked extensively to clear the wreckage and attend to the victims, but despite their efforts, the crash resulted in fatalities. The California Highway Patrol (CHP) and other authorities responded to the incident, with the coroner’s office being notified. At this time, the cause of the crash remains under investigation. All lanes were closed for several hours while cleanup crews worked to remove the wreckage and reopen the road. The area was expected to remain closed well into the night, causing significant delays for those traveling in the region.
